AirServer is a popular software application that enables users to stream and record content from their iOS devices to their computers. AirServer is a media streaming software that allows users to stream audio, video, and photo content from their iOS, Android, and Windows devices to their computers, smart TVs, and other devices on the same network. Developed by AirServer, a company based in the UK, the software has gained a significant following among users who want to enjoy their media content on a larger screen.
